Jared Jones: Rising Star with Improved Velocity

Jared Jones, a 24-year-old pitcher for the Pittsburgh Pirates, is making a strong comeback from an internal brace procedure on his elbow. His rehab starts have shown impressive results, with an ERA of 1.88, WHIP of 0.98, and a K/9 of 11.3. Jones' fastball velocity has increased by 1.5 mph, reaching an average of 98.8 mph. This improvement in velocity makes him a valuable addition to any fantasy team, especially considering his potential impact as an impact pitcher on the waiver wire.
